### Navigating The Login Portal
The first step to accessing your academic dashboard is reaching the official login page. It is crucial to ensure you are on the correct, district-sanctioned website to avoid phishing scams or data breaches. The URL is typically standardized across the district, but bookmarks can help ensure consistency.
Once on the page, users are prompted to enter specific credentials. This usually involves an assigned username and a secure password. For students, the username is often derived from their student ID number or a formatted version of their name. Parents accessing the system to view their child’s progress may need a separate parent portal account, sometimes linked to the student’s ID.
* **Username Format:** Typically the student ID or a variation of the student’s full name.
* **Password Requirements:** Often includes a mix of uppercase, lowercase, numbers, and special characters.
* **Network Restrictions:** Some accounts may require login attempts to originate from within the district’s network or via a VPN.
If the standard credentials fail, the platform usually provides a "Forgot Password?" link. Clicking this generally triggers a security protocol, such as sending a reset link to a registered email address or generating a temporary code via text message. Following these automated prompts carefully is essential to regain access without delay.

### Troubleshooting Common Access Issues
Despite the straightforward design, users occasionally encounter barriers that prevent smooth navigation. A common issue is account lockout after multiple failed password attempts. This security feature, while protective, can be inconvenient. Resolution typically requires contacting the school’s IT helpdesk or technology department for manual intervention.
Another frequent problem involves mismatched credentials between the LMS and the district’s primary directory. If a user recently changed their password or their student ID format is incorrect, the login will fail. In these scenarios, verifying the exact username format provided by the school is the first troubleshooting step. Ensuring that CAPS LOCK is not active can also resolve unexpected access denials.
For technical difficulties specific to the platform, such as buttons not responding or videos not loading, clearing the browser cache or trying a different browser is recommended. LAUSD’s LMS is often optimized for specific browsers, and using an outdated version of Chrome, Firefox, or Safari can lead to performance issues.
